Lime, a calcium-containing inorganic mineral composed of oxide and hydroxide compounds, plays a crucial role in the global iron and steel industry. The primary raw materials, limestone and chalk, undergo a calcination process at temperatures above 800°C, breaking down the carbonate compound into highly caustic calcium oxide (quicklime) and releasing carbon dioxide. This versatile chemical is extensively used as a building and engineering resource, chemical feedstock, and for the refinement of sugar crystals. The steel manufacturing industry is the largest consumer of lime, with the product serving as a flux promoter that facilitates the separation of impurities such as silica and phosphorus through slag formation. Lime is added to basic oxygen furnaces and electric arc furnaces during the steel production process. The utilization of lime to treat wastewater and flue gases is gaining traction due to its ability to capture pollutants like lead and SOx emissions. As pollution control regulations become more stringent in countries such as the U.S., China, and India, the demand for lime in the iron and steel industry is expected to grow significantly. The global iron and steel industry is undergoing a significant transformation, driven by the need for sustainable practices and the reduction of carbon emissions. As a result, the demand for lime in steel production is expected to evolve, with a focus on developing fossil-fuel-free lime as part of the roadmap towards fossil-free steel. Lime plays a crucial role in the steel manufacturing process, contributing CaO molecules that enable steel plants to maintain the right basicity in the steel slag during the initial metallurgical steps. This property of the slag is essential for removing impurities from the steel, as the appropriate slag property enhances the transfer of impurities from the melt into the slag. Different steel plants have varying demands for slag chemistry, depending on factors such as the type and amount of impurities to be removed, refractory chemistry, and the type of melting process used. This means that steel plants have unique requirements, and lime suppliers must adapt to meet these demands. A common requirement is low sulfur and phosphorus content in lime, as these are some of the most common elements to be removed from the steel melt when generating steel slag. As the world moves towards reducing carbon emissions, the steel industry is exploring alternative technologies to lower its environmental impact. One example is the Hybrit project, which aims to produce steel using hydrogen instead of carbon, eliminating the need for blast furnaces. This shift will not only change the demands for lime size fraction but also the chemistry required.

• Raw Material Availability and Quality:The availability and quality of raw materials, particularly limestone, pose significant challenges for the lime market in the iron and steel industry. Lime is primarily produced by calcining limestone, and the quality and purity of the available limestone significantly impact the final product's quality. High-quality limestone reserves are not evenly distributed worldwide, leading to regional disparities in lime production and supply. Additionally, the depletion of limestone reserves due to extensive mining can lead to scarcity and increased prices, adversely affecting the lime market. Variations in limestone quality can result in inconsistent lime products, impacting their effectiveness in steel production processes.
• Energy Costs and Environmental Concerns:Energy costs and environmental concerns present notable challenges for the lime market in the iron and steel industry. Lime production is an energy-intensive process, requiring significant amounts of heat to calcine limestone. High energy costs can substantially increase the production costs of lime, making it less economically viable for steel producers. Additionally, the calcination process releases considerable amounts of carbon dioxide (CO2), contributing to greenhouse gas emissions and raising environmental concerns. As awareness of climate change grows, there is increasing pressure on industries to reduce their carbon footprint. The lime industry must address these challenges by improving energy efficiency and exploring low-emission technologies to mitigate the environmental impact of lime production and maintain its competitiveness in the market.

• Technological Advancements:Technological advancements are shaping the lime market in the iron and steel industry, driving it towards more efficient and sustainable practices. Traditional lime production methods are being replaced or upgraded with advanced technologies like rotary kilns and vertical shaft kilns, which offer improved energy efficiency and reduced emissions. These technologies allow for better heat transfer, reduced fuel consumption, and enhanced control over the calcination process, resulting in higher-quality lime products. Innovations in carbon capture and storage (CCS) technologies hold promise for reducing the environmental impact of lime production by capturing and storing the CO2 released during calcination.
• Increasing Use of High-Purity Lime:The increasing use of high-purity lime is a notable trend in the iron and steel industry, driven by the need for more efficient and cleaner steel production processes. High-purity lime, characterized by its low levels of impurities like silica and magnesia, offers several advantages in steel production. It enhances the removal of impurities from molten iron, improves the quality of refractory materials, and reduces the need for additional purification steps, leading to improved steel quality and reduced production costs. The demand for high-purity lime is growing as steel producers aim to optimize their processes and meet stringent quality standards.

Quicklime and hydrated lime are two key types of lime used extensively in the iron and steel industry. Quicklime, or calcium oxide (CaO), is produced by heating limestone (calcium carbonate) to high temperatures of around 900°C, driving off carbon dioxide and leaving behind a caustic white solid. Hydrated lime, or calcium hydroxide (Ca(OH)2), is created by adding water to quicklime in a process called slaking. In steel manufacturing, quicklime serves as a flux that helps remove impurities like silica and phosphorus by forming a slag. It is added to basic oxygen furnaces and electric arc furnaces to facilitate this purification process. Quicklime's high density of 65 lb/ft3 makes it more reactive than hydrated lime. However, its exothermic reaction with water requires specialized slaking equipment. Hydrated lime is less reactive but still finds use in flue gas desulfurization systems at coal-fired power plants, cement factories, and incinerators. It helps filter out harmful emissions like SOx, NOx, and HCl. Hydrated lime is also preferred when smaller quantities of lime solution are needed, as it can be fed directly into slurry tanks without the need for a slaker.

Lime is essential for desulfurization processes in steelmaking. It reacts with sulfur impurities in molten iron to form calcium sulfide, which is then removed as slag. This is particularly important because high sulfur content can adversely affect the mechanical properties of steel. Innovative methods, such as lime-based desulfurization in foundries, involve injecting a mixture of fine lime and coal into molten iron, effectively lowering sulfur levels from around 0.1% to below 0.015% within minutes, thus enhancing the quality of the final product. As a regulator, lime helps control the chemical composition of the steel by neutralizing acidic impurities and adjusting the pH levels during various stages of production. This regulatory role is crucial in maintaining the desired properties of the steel. Additionally, lime acts as a protective agent by forming a slag layer that protects the molten steel from oxidation, thereby preserving its quality during processing. Beyond these primary applications, lime is utilized in various other capacities within the steel industry. It serves as a fluxing agent in electric arc furnaces and basic oxygen furnaces, facilitating the removal of impurities such as silica and phosphorus. Furthermore, hydrated lime is employed in secondary metallurgy for refining processes, enhancing the overall quality of steel by ensuring it is well deoxidized and clean.
